Here is a super easy one but really good.
Romain lettuce, roughly chopped
1/2 grapefruit, sectioned, pith removed, chopped into bite size pieces
almond slivers
poppy seed dressing
optional--grilled chicken breast
The acidity of the grapefruit goes great with the sweetness of the poppy seed dressing. You have to try it to believe how good it is.

I think my salads may be as bad as a cheeseburger. I basically can't do rabbit food without huge amounts of cheese.
My faves:
cubed bread + cucumber chunks + tomato chunks + fresh mozzarella + vinaigrette
lettuce (any) + ham chunks + sharp cheddar + avocado + cucumber + ranch
I also do caesar with croutons, made by cubing french bread, tossed with olive oil + s+p + heaps of grated parmesan, and toasted on 350 for about 15 minutes.
mixed greens plus strawberries, pineapple, candied walnuts, feta cheese and champagne vinegarette.
